COMPLETED
A Study to Evaluate the Safety, Tolerability and Preliminary Efficacy of APP13007 to Treat Inflammation and Pain After Cataract Surgery
Description

This is a Phase 2a, 2-part study (designated Parts A and B) that will evaluate APP13007 dose strength and dosing frequency in a randomized double-masked fashion for comparison to the respective matching vehicle placebo. Part A will be conducted first to evaluate 0.05% APP13007 and matching vehicle placebo in an approximate 1:1 ratio in approximately 42 subjects who experience postoperative inflammation on the first day following routine, uncomplicated, cataract surgery and who meet all eligibility criteria. Based on the results of Part A, Part B of the study may be open for enrollment to evaluate 0.05% and/or 0.1% APP13007 at various dosing frequency in approximately 84 subjects, also in an approximate 1:1 ratio, active vs. placebo. In each Part, subjects will return periodically for study assessments during the treatment period and then for a follow-up visit approximately 1 week after stopping the study drug.

COMPLETED
Safety/Efficacy of Nepafenac Punctal Plug Delivery System Compared to Placebo to Control Ocular Pain/Inflammation After Cataract
Description

This is a Phase 2, multi-center, randomized, parallel-arm, double-masked, placebo-controlled study. One (1) to 2 days prior to their scheduled cataract surgery, each study subject will be randomized (2:1) in to one of two treatment groups: N-PPDS or p-PPDS, which are inserted in the lower punctum of the subject's scheduled surgical eye. All plugs will remain in the study subject's lower punctum for a period of 2 weeks following cataract surgery.

RECRUITING
Dextenza in the Post-op Management of Vitreoretinal Surgeries
Description

This study will assess the control of inflammation at days 1, 7, 14, and 21 days following the vitreoretinal surgical procedure analyzing two randomized study arms: Intracanalicular dexamethasone insert group or topical steroid drop group. Patients must be 18 years of age and older, of any race and either sex, requiring surgery with the procedure type of pars plana vitrectomy for either the indication of macular hole, epiretinal membrane removal, or vitreomacular traction.
